This is an NGO working in the redlight area of Kamathipura district in Mumabi. They have a day care centre for children of commercial sex workers. These children have a common pattern of behavioral issues like aggression and abusive language which can be related to both -- their growing up experience and an influence of the environment.
Here, our human and canine therapists work with these children to control their aggression, curb their tempers and acquire gentility. The children realize that violence, to which many of them have become accustomed, is not a healthy way to communicate and that living creatures, animal or mankind, respond positively to a loving touch.
For most of the children, it is the first time they have experienced a healthy relationship with another living being. The non-threatening nature of the animals also helps them tolerate more threatening stimuli, such as their home environment.
